Fans and Critics Unite: Dhurandhar Becomes One of 2025’s Most Talked-About Films
‘Dhurandhar’ is dominating the box office with strong weekend numbers and glowing reviews, pushing it toward the ₹200-crore milestone and a worldwide total of ₹274.25 crore.
Aditya Dhar’s latest directorial venture, Dhurandhar, is witnessing an extraordinary wave of appreciation from fans, critics, and industry veterans alike. The film has quickly established itself as a powerhouse at the box office, steadily marching toward the coveted ₹200-crore mark. With its remarkable day-to-day earnings and unwavering audience interest, the milestone seems not just achievable, but imminent.
The film opened to an impressive ₹28 crore on Friday, followed by ₹32 crore on Saturday. Its collection surged on Sunday, bringing in ₹43 crore. In addition to its domestic run, Dhurandhar has garnered ₹58 crore overseas in six days, pushing its worldwide total to ₹274.25 crore.
Industry buzz suggests that the film may even surpass the performance of Bajirao Mastani, another Ranveer Singh starrer known for its strong box office run.
Beyond its commercial success, the film which is not for the faint-hearted, is also earning significant attention for its reviews. Among those praising the movie is Hrithik Roshan, who shared a heartfelt response to the film.
“I love cinema; I love people who climb into a vortex and let the story take control—spin them, shake them—until what they want to say is purged out of them onto that screen. Dhurandhar is an example of that. Loved the storytelling. It’s cinema,” Roshan said.
He further added, “I may disagree with the politics of it and argue about the responsibilities we filmmakers should bear as citizens of the world. Nevertheless, I can’t ignore how much I loved and learned from this one as a student of cinema. Amazing.”
Ranveer Singh who has completed 15 years in Bollywood, has been widely appreciated by followers. Ranveer Singh plays the role of Indian Intelligence Agent Hamza Ali Mazari, whose real name is Jaskirat Singh Rangi. Industry analysts say Dhurandhar could be a defining film in Ranveer’s career, positioning him as one of the leading figures in contemporary Bollywood.
Interestingly, it is not just Ranveer who is commanding attention. Akshaye Khanna, known for his understated brilliance, has emerged as one of the film’s most striking revelations. His popularity has surged dramatically, powered by his intense screen presence and magnetic performance amidst a talented ensemble that includes R. Madhavan, Sanjay Dutt, and Arjun Rampal.
Khanna plays Rehman Dakait, the feared Baloch gangster who once ruled the streets of Lyari through sheer terror. His portrayal has been described as “enigmatic”—a blend of quiet menace and psychological depth that has left audiences captivated. Many viewers and critics believe this may be one of the most memorable roles of his career.
The Hindi-language espionage action thriller written, directed, and co-produced by Aditya Dhar. The film was released in theatres on December 5, 2025 and has become one of the biggest hits of the year.
With strong word-of-mouth and sustained audience support, Dhurandhar continues to strengthen its position as one of the year’s standout releases.
